The Dansai......
People have used this sentence before but I'll use it again :
If I cut a bit of cardboard into a circle and loaded it into this machine it would play it no problem.
I've created XSVCD's with 7000kb rates - Ripped out 700 Meg vobs from DVD's and just burnt it as an ISO data disc and its played it - Put Mp3's onto discs, left the sessions open, closed whatever and its played it. Any colour CDR / CDRW. Given it DVD-R no problem. Picture quality is top notch as long as you output as scart RGB or through the AV RCA's.
This player for £99.94 wipes the floor with the other budget competition full stop. -
